The main indicators for the use of the scrub are dryness and peeling. Regular foot care will help to make the skin healthy, smooth, well-hydrated.
The scrub is convenient to use, requires a minimum amount for the procedure, is easily distributed over the skin, has a slight foaming, is completely washed off, leaving a feeling of lightness, freshness and cleanliness.
Essential oils of spruce and eucalyptus have pronounced antiseptic properties, accelerate healing, increase the protective functions of the skin, reduce sweating.
Natural menthol reduces the oiliness of the skin, relieves fatigue, reduces puffiness, deodorizes.
The antibacterial properties of magnesia fight excessive sweating, prevent the appearance of fungus, neutralizes unpleasant odor.
Arnica macerate (in olive oil) has anti-inflammatory, healing, decongestant, antibacterial properties. Eliminates pain and a feeling of heaviness in the legs.
It will be an excellent preparation for manicure or massage procedures.
The use of a scrub:
* Improves blood flow
* Starts the renewal of skin cells
* Allows the massage oil to penetrate deeper and produce a moisturizing effect
Method of application
Apply with massage movements from the heel to the fingers after water procedures or baths with salt, carefully distribute over the entire surface of the foot, rinse with water, apply a caring cream.

Composition: cosmetic base made in Russia, arnica macerate (in olive oil), non-ionic surfactant, natural menthol, sea salt, magnesia sulfate, cosmetic pigment, pumice stone, essential oils of mint, spruce, eucalyptus
